## Escalation: Report Export Timezones

If scheduled exports in Ledgerline show timestamps shifted by several hours, the cause is almost always a mismatch between the tenant's configured zone and the export worker's default UTC assumption. First confirm the tenant setting in the admin panel, then check the worker logs for zone coercion warnings. Do not hotfix the formatter; file a release blocker instead. If the discrepancy persists after one redeploy, escalate to the export platform team directly.

escalation mailbox, bafog-fafog: ulador@paliqlabs.internal

Subject: Hardware lab access — your visit tomorrow

Hello,

Thanks for confirming your visit to Gablewood Systems tomorrow. Please check in at the front desk on arrival; someone from the facilities team will walk you to the hardware lab on Level 2. Contractors aren't issued permanent badges, so you'll use a temporary keypad entry valid for the day only. The door code for your visit is below.

staff pass of kawip-hawef = bdg-QLP-2

## Configuration

Meridel's calendar sync resolves conflicts by comparing the `updated_at` stamp from the Tidewell API against the local cache. When two edits land within the same five-second window, the resolver falls back to the remote copy, which reviewers should note is a deliberate choice to avoid duplicating recurring events. Conflict resolution requires an authenticated session against the Tidewell conflict endpoint. Add the following line to your `.env` before running the sync worker.

secret setting of yafof-tawep: RELAY_SECRET8=8abb5772

Checklist item 14 — Bounce processor (Mailstrom service). Confirm the suppression-list writer is pointed at the production table, not the rehearsal copy used during the Fenwick drill. Run the synthetic hard-bounce probe and verify the sender is suppressed within 60 seconds. Record the outcome in the release log. The candidate build under verification appears below.

build token for tawip-yageg: htk9_92ac43d42